I don't know about the original poster, but I got a job in January. And in the 8 months since I was hired Mac Air hired two, Kavango hired one, and Sefo hired four pilots. Still bad odds considering at least 5 times that many people looking for jobs have come through town without any luck. I doubt more than a small hand full of jobs will come up this winter but now one really knows. IF you want to fly here and you can afford to take a huge risk than give it a shot. Just be selective about who you work for and what you sign, don't just take any job offered to you.
